Update - G&R Lawn Maintenance / Electrical Contractor -
The Board unanimously agreed to hire G&R which also provides electrical and irrigation maintenance.
Work Order have been sent to G&R:
1. Repair the electrical and Plumbing at the pavilion
FINDING
*The light bulb on the light poles work - when the last person who changed out the new bulbs they broke the sockets, sockets is on order and will be installed asap
*The back flow preventer is broke - new one on order and will be installed asap
2. Repair the nonfunctional fountain in the small pond
FINDING
*The fountain works- electrical line that feeds the fountain will be replaced next week - contractor has to bring his small boat to pull the fountain out to make the repairs
3. Repair the lights at the entrance
FINDING
*1 photo cell is bad and will be replaced
*8 lights bad bulbs - pricing replacement fixtures using soft LED light *Electrical boxes re secured to the mounts and electrical wiring was falling out of the boxes - contractor fixed this issue.
*All irrigation piping was wrapped with insulation due to the freezing weather To all, the Lawn Maintenance will resume Feb 1st serviced by G&R.
They will also keep the walking trail clean and free from debris as part of the contract.
